Problems with a door lock that has a power actuator

If you've noticed noises coming from your door lock's actuator there could be a problem. This could be caused by the Door lock assembly Repair lock's power not receiving enough power. It could also keep moving and leading to battery drain. If you suspect the door lock's motor is defective, it's recommended to have it examined by a professional. The repair process usually doesn't take long, but the technician might need to order parts and wait for a few days for them to arrive.

Intermittent operation is the most common issue with power-door actuators. If this happens, the driver can see the lock move, but cannot disconnect it. If the actuator fails completely, the only option is to replace the latch assembly. This is a simple fix, and many domestic automobile actuators are affordable.

First, test the power door lock actuator by using the test light or an automotive meter. Make sure it shows 12 V across the electrical connector. If the meter shows negative readings, then it's highly likely that the solenoid or actuator motor is the culprit.

Damage and corrosion are another common problem with power door lock actuators. The mechanic must inspect all the parts of the door lock actuator that have been damaged during a collision to make sure that they aren't damaged. Door lock actuators can cease to function if they're damaged.

Remove the cover from the door lock actuator power source to check it. Two bolts secure the actuator in place. The L-shaped pin on the cover is the one you'll need remove. Next, disconnect the cable that connects the actuator to the power door lock actuator.

Cost of a door lock powered by actuator

A door lock actuator powered by power is a part of auto door locks repair. It goes into motion each time you open or close the door of your car boot lock repair near me. It is therefore susceptible to damage or failure. Depending on the make and model of your vehicle and the distance you've driven in the past, an actuator may require replacement.

If your door lock actuator requires repair, it is recommended to consult an expert mechanic. The repair of an actuator for a door lock is expensiveand is not recommended for routine maintenance. The power door lock actuator should be replaced only if it ceases to function. The cost of replacing the door lock actuator power will differ depending on the car you have. It's about $200 to $300 for a basic vehicle, but it can be as high as seven hundred dollars for exotic cars.
